When Trust is Broken: What Qualifies as Medical Malpractice?


Clinical negligence occurs when a doctor deviates from the accepted standard of care, and that deviation results in injury to a person. It's not enough that an inadequate end result happened; the focus lies in whether the healthcare specialist acted negligently or incompetently.


Some usual situations include:



  • A postponed medical diagnosis that aggravates an individual's condition

  • Surgery executed on the wrong site

  • Wrong medicine dosage or prescription

  • Birth injuries arising from incorrect prenatal treatment


In these situations, showing negligence entails demonstrating that a clinical requirement was breached, which breach created direct injury. This isn't always very easy-- and that's where a competent supporter comes in.

Patient Rights: More Than Just a Legal Concept


As a client, you have legal rights-- and those civil liberties are not optional. They're the structure of secure and moral clinical therapy. Among one of the most crucial rights is the right to informed permission. This implies you must be completely enlightened about the possible threats and benefits of any kind of treatment or procedure before it takes place.


You additionally can prompt and experienced care, the right to ask concerns, and the right to receive honest answers. When any of these rights are jeopardized, and harm results, it ends up being a matter worth investigating.

From Doubt to Action: What to Do If You Suspect Malpractice


If you believe that you or a liked one has been a victim of clinical negligence, it can be challenging to know where to start. The most vital step is to trust your instincts. If something feels off, you have every right to ask questions and seek a consultation.


Begin by collecting all your medical records and documenting your experience. Write down dates, names of medical service providers, and the information of conversations and therapies. This information can come to be important in building an instance.


Next, seek advice from a lawyer that focuses on clinical negligence or injury legislation.
